COMPANY OVERVIEW

Balchem Corporation develops, manufactures, and markets specialty ingredients that improve and enhance the health and well-being of life on the planet, providing state-of-the-art solutions and the finest quality products for a range of industries worldwide. Our corporate headquarters is located in Montvale, New Jersey and we have a broad network of sales offices, manufacturing sites, and R&D centers, primarily located in the US and Europe. Founded in 1967, Balchem is a publicly traded company (NASDAQ - BCPC) with annual revenues over $900 million and a market cap exceeding $4.0 billion. The company consists of three business segments: Human Nutrition & Health; Animal Nutrition & Health; and Specialty Products. Balchem employs over 1,400 people worldwide who are engaged in diverse activities, committed to developing the company into global market leadership positions. POSITION SUMMARY: Performs quality and safety testing of incoming ingredients, in-process and finished products. The Quality Assurance Warehouse Technician also supports the quality assurance programs. Directly reports to the Quality Assurance Manager for proper direction, interpretation, and evaluation. Maintains and guarantees Balchem Corporation's quality and safety standards.

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S:

  • Performs inspections to company standards for all incoming raw material and packaging inspection
  • Perform all positive releases for sampling and testing
  • Prepare samples for analysis in outside laboratories; maintains sample inventory of raw and finished samples
  • Manage sample program, document, administer and file raw materials samples
  • Respond to customer and QA sample request fulfillment
  • Manages and updates site's access to corporate COA program
  • Provides vendor information and support through TraceGains program
  • Provides support for corporate supply chain quality team
  • Manages Document control program
  • Lab supply inventory and management (ATP, allergen and EV swabs)
  • Manages holds program
  • Observe safety and security procedures, determine appropriate action beyond guidelines, and report potentially unsafe conditions
  • Monitor and maintain product quality to meet company standards; report to Manager any deviation from quality that may become a potential liability

REQUIREMENTS:

  • Lab experience is required, and food-handling experience is desirable
  • HACCP knowledge and understanding required/PCQI preferred
  • Must have sound analytical and technical skills
